#1
|
|||
|
|||
Pluralsight downloader misses videos in a playlist
Pluralsight decrypter is not grabbing all links, in the example link it grabbed 105 while they are 115 videos. Missing videos in module 4,7,8,10,12 in the example link
Log: 19.07.21 13.58.58 <--> 19.07.21 14.02.54 jdlog://6115825302851/ Example link: **External links are only visible to Support Staff****External links are only visible to Support Staff** Java Version: 1.8.0_162 Jdownloader Build Date: Jul 19 OS: Windows 10 Edit: Is it possible for it to also download subtitles? Last edited by Mir; 19.07.2021 at 14:07. Reason: Add question |
#2
|
||||
|
||||
Hi,
I'm unable to confirm your issue. Module 4 e.g. has 9 clips. The total number of 105 clips appears to be the correct one for this course. Can you see more via browser? Do you own a (paid) pluralsight.com? Maybe you can only view all clips when logged in. In this case, add your pluralsight.com account to JD (Settings -> Account Manager) and re-add that course.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#3
|
|||
|
|||
Hello,
Model 4 has 10 clips **External links are only visible to Support Staff**... I'm also logged in pluralsight and downloading using my account and I added the course after I logged in. I didn't know I can download videos without logging in. I can provide the account to test if needed. I have a question too, is it possible to download subtitles using Jdownloader? They appear in the html page HTML Code:
<video id="video-element" class="_2oZ8UJaJ" preload="auto" playsinline="" src="blob:**External links are only visible to Support Staff**><track label="English" kind="captions" srclang="en" src="/transcript/api/v1/caption/webvtt/b92b7bcf-9d4c-4ac2-8e6a-ee728e49f1d4/af2e819f-c8c0-40ad-aa3a-f3cc63f486e0/en/"></video> |
#4
|
||||
|
||||
Quote:
Yes this appears to be possible - at least for some of the clips. Please send your pluralsight login credentials to support@jdownloader.org Quote:
You can try the following method to get the videos + subtitles: https://support.jdownloader.org/Know...aming-websites -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#5
|
|||
|
|||
Quote:
|
#6
|
||||
|
||||
@Mir. Thanks, I've forwared them to pspzockerscene, he will check as soon as he finds time
__________________
JD-Dev & Server-Admin |
#7
|
|||
|
|||
Quote:
@pspzockerscene, BTW the missing video names are not always the correct missing one. For example in module 4: the one was missing was the last one (video 10) titled "Checklists and Summary". Instead, JDownloader downloaded the video (9) titled "Something's Wrong" and named it "Checklists and Summary" Also when I browse the link **External links are only visible to Support Staff****External links are only visible to Support Staff** on incognito without logging in I can see module 4 has 10 videos https://i.imgur.com/xbFta8a.png Edit: Same thing with module 7, it downloaded the video before the last and named it by the last video name Last edited by Mir; 20.07.2021 at 02:07. |
#8
|
||||
|
||||
@Mir
I'm working on it but I will need more time as I basically have to rewrite that plugin. In the meantime you are free to download the missing clips via this method. Also I need your pluralsight account for some more days so please do not change your password yet.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#9
|
|||
|
|||
Thank you @psp, take your time and I will not change the password feel free to use it but be careful if downloading because they are aggressive with account locking.
If I'm allowed to make a request could you please also take a look at the possibility of grabbing subtitles? They are in the src property of the element with <track> tag inside the <video> tag. Thank you. |
#10
|
||||
|
||||
@Mir: Their api does not return the full list of entries and the numbering also comes directly from API. it just misses some entries. Have you tested in browser if those missing entries do work/exist in browser?
Maybe sort of api error or specific issue with those missing entries.
__________________
JD-Dev & Server-Admin |
#11
|
||||
|
||||
This issue will be fixed after the next update.
@Mir You can change the password of your pluralsight account - I don't need it anymore for testing! Wartest du auf einen angekündigten Bugfix oder ein neues Feature? Updates werden nicht immer sofort bereitgestellt! Bitte lies unser Update FAQ! | Please read our Update FAQ! --- Are you waiting for recently announced changes to get released? Updates to not necessarily get released immediately! Bitte lies unser Update FAQ! | Please read our Update FAQ! -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#12
|
|||
|
|||
Quote:
Quote:
Thank you. |
#13
|
||||
|
||||
The fix has already been released so by deleting- and re-adding that course, you should get all items.
The account only needs to be present when downloading videos otherwise you might not be able to download all items.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#14
|
|||
|
|||
Thanks a lot for your efforts
|
#15
|
|||
|
|||
@psp,
No matter what course I add it just only adds the one I sent here earlier **External links are only visible to Support Staff****External links are only visible to Support Staff** example : trying to add this **External links are only visible to Support Staff****External links are only visible to Support Staff** or this **External links are only visible to Support Staff****External links are only visible to Support Staff** will result in the link grapper grapping this **External links are only visible to Support Staff****External links are only visible to Support Staff** |
#16
|
||||
|
||||
Works fine here.
Did you add your pluralsight.com account to JD? If so, please try the following: 1. Remove- or deactivate your pluralsight account in JD and deleteall previously added links in your linkgrabber. 2. Now try to add the above URLs again - does it work now? If that doesn't change anything, please post a DEBUG-log: (Be sure to enable debug mode first, see linked instructions!) Please post your log-ID here | bitte poste deine Log-ID hier. -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#17
|
|||
|
|||
Thank you. logging out and in again fixed the issue for me.
If I wanted to save the files in a folder structure something like $(PackageName)/$(chapter_number)-$(chapter_title)/$(title).$(extention) is something like that doable with EventScripter or does it have to be embedded in the plugin itself?? |
#18
|
||||
|
||||
You can try to extract that information from the existing filenames and set it as download path using a Packagizer rule.
Next update should fix this issue so you can leave your account enabled. Wartest du auf einen angekündigten Bugfix oder ein neues Feature? Updates werden nicht immer sofort bereitgestellt! Bitte lies unser Update FAQ! | Please read our Update FAQ! --- Are you waiting for recently announced changes to get released? Updates to not necessarily get released immediately! Bitte lies unser Update FAQ! | Please read our Update FAQ! -psp-
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download |
#19
|
|||
|
|||
Quote:
If I understood correctly I'll need to save it to Code:
<jd:orgpackagename>/<jd:prop:ChapterIndex> - <jd:prop:Chapter Title>/<jd:prop:FileTitle> |
#20
|
||||
|
||||
Hi again,
here is a list of possible properties for pluralsight.com:
For better understanding - here is a filename example: Code:
03-04 - Here is a module title -- Name of the clip.mp4 Code:
module-module_clip_order_id - module_title -- module_clip_title.mp4 The bold ones are not yet available but will be after the next CORE-update. Please note that using the packagizer, you can also take parts of the filename and do whatever you want with them so what you want is already possible (with any name of any plugin!) without the need of an update but it's 'harder' to accomplish as Regular expressions are involved. Wartest du auf einen angekündigten Bugfix oder ein neues Feature? Updates werden nicht immer sofort bereitgestellt! Bitte lies unser Update FAQ! | Please read our Update FAQ! --- Are you waiting for recently announced changes to get released? Updates to not necessarily get released immediately! Bitte lies unser Update FAQ! | Please read our Update FAQ! -psp- EDIT Here is a simple path-example which will put all items into "downloadfolder/packagename/moduleNumber": Code:
C:\Users\example\Downloads\jdtest\<jd:orgpackagename>\<jd:prop:module>
__________________
JD Supporter, Plugin Dev. & Community Manager
Erste Schritte & Tutorials || JDownloader 2 Setup Download Last edited by pspzockerscene; 28.07.2021 at 14:03. |
#21
|
|||
|
|||
Thanks
Perfect thank you. looking forward for the next other properties for now the module will make it much better organizing the course thank you. |
Thread Tools | |
Display Modes | |
|
|